Manchester United legend Patrice Evra will jump into the boxing ring to fight in an exhibition match against the popular YouTuber

Patrice Evra keeps giving what to talk about Although more than two years have passed since his retirement from the judiciary. Manchester United legend Now this is news because he decided to take off his cleats and put on his gloves to jump in the boxing ring and Fighting YouTuber Adam Saleh.

Fighting Between Frenchman Evra and Saleh there will be no one because It will take place at the legendary O2 Arenaone of the largest entertainment centers in England with a stadium, cinema, bars and more.

The battle was scheduled to take place on April 30, 2022 Evra was himself, in conversations with the sun He made it clear that he hoped to have the full support of fans not only in London but across the UK.

“This fight will be on April 30th at the O2 Arena in London, so I will need my entire British family to stop and show their love; Not only from London but from all over the UK. I need them because this is going to be really crazy,” Evra expressed.

The former football player hopes to attract fans as this is his first experience as a boxer. It wouldn’t be the case for a valid rival.

The New York-born but Yemeni-born man has already fought twice against Marcus Stephenson, Walid Sharks and Anas Al Shayeb, racking up a record two wins and a tie in amateur boxing.

This is the new event for Evra who since his farewell with West Ham in 2019 has dedicated himself to creating witty content on social media.In addition to working as a football analyst for various TV channels in England.
